  • Chefs Special Origin

Why not talk about the chefs’ specials in your menu. These will often be the curries that will set you apart from the other Indian restaurants. Talk about each curry, the ingredients in it and the inspiration behind it. Share recommendations of the best naan and rice to go with it too. These things will all help set you apart from the other Indian restaurants. One blog post per chef special curry will work well too.

  • Curry And Beer or Wine?

Answer the questions that are often asked by customers in the restaurant. Is there a curry that goes well with one particular beer? Maybe red wine is perfect with one type of curry, but white wine is much better for a different type of curry? Share these recommendations with your target audience. Another recommendation might be the best sides to have with different curries. All these things will be useful to diners looking to try something new.

  • Heat Guide to Curries

Use this blog post to talk about the different curry types and their heat. Do different species cool down or heat up the flavour of a curry? Maybe you have sauces people can have with a curry to cool it down, if they want to try a hotter one? Perhaps you offer a selection of curries so different heats of curry can be tried?
